Vice President – Loss Forecasting and Stress Testing Analytics

Citi

Vice President in Loss Forecasting and Stress Testing Analytics team at Citi managing credit loss forecasts. Collaborating cross-functionally to enhance risk management processes and improve efficiencies.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Work independently to effectively execute Quarterly loss / loan loss reserve forecasting and stress testing processes (CCAR, QMMF, Recovery Plan) deliverables for one or more retail portfolios with primary focus on NA cards.
  • Associated governance activities (Manager Control Assessment, End User Computing, Activity Risk Control Monitoring and its Assessment Units).
  • Cross-portfolio and cross-functional collaboration on loss / loan loss reserve forecasting and stress testing analytics.
  • Assist in review and challenge of existing models, and model outputs to identify areas of improvement relative to portfolio & macro-economic trends.
  • Understand the calculation of reserves, components of P&L, and the impact of CECL on CCAR results besides understanding the synergies between two processes.
  • Collaborate with other teams like Risk Modeling, Portfolio & New Account Forecasting, Data Reporting and Finance to complete requests on financial planning & CCAR/DFAST results and increased integration of credit risk & PPNR results.
  • Perform complex risk policy analytics in terms of sizing the impact of credit/business/regulatory policies on loss performance and incorporate it into the stress testing process.
  • Perform econometric analysis to estimate and explain the impact of changing macroeconomic trends on Portfolio Performance Losses, delinquency etc.
  • Establish and continually evolve standardized business and submission documentation.
  • Collaborate with Risk and Finance organization to understand sources of data and continue to improve the process of defining, extracting and utilizing data.
  • Identify areas of improvement in BAU and drive process efficiency through process simplification and automation (VBA, SAS, etc.).
  • Execute information controls (version control, central results summary) to meet business objectives with utmost clarity.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 10+ years work experience in financial services, business analytics or management consulting.
  • Understanding of risk management.
  • Knowledge of credit card industry and key regulatory activities (CCAR) is a plus.
  • Experience in CCAR / DFAST/Stress Testing is preferred.
  • Strong understanding and hands-on experience with econometric and empirical forecasting models.
  • Experience in data science / machine learning is preferred with ability to handle large datasets.
  • Experience in using analytical packages like SAS, datacube/Essbase, MS Office (Excel, Powerpoint).
  • Vision and ability to provide innovative solutions to core business practices.
  • Ability to develop partnerships across multiple business and functional areas.
  • Strong written and oral communication skills.
